(ANSA) - ROME, JUN 20 - Italy's Antitrust authority said
Thursday that it has fined Dr Automobiles S.r.l. and its
subsidiary DR Service & Parts S.r.l. six million euros for
improper trading practices.
The authority said the company had marketed its DR and Evo brand
cars as being produced in Italy, as least since December 2021,
when they were actually made in China, except for some minor
adjustments. (ANSA).
